Household of Charles Langlois

He is married to Marie Cordier.

They got married on May 25, 1645 at Rouen, Seine-Maritime, Haute-Normandie, France, he was 27 years old.

Conjoint:

Child(ren):

  1. Nicolas Langlois  1640-1721 
  2. Denis Langlois  1650-1689
  3. Marie Langlois  1652-????
  4. René Langlois  1654-????
  5. Jérome Langlois  1658-1688
  6. Jean Langlois  1661-1769
  7. Jeanne Salles  1664-????
